Find the moment of force of 20 N about an axis of rotation at a distance of 0.5 m from the force.

Answer
Given:
Force f = 20 N
Distance d = 0.5 m
Moment of force = ?
Moment of force = force f x distance d
= 20 x 0.5
= 10 N m
So, the moment of force = 10 N m.
